Breaking:Police Parade 123 Suspected internet fraudsters in Delta

…police display laptops and accessories, mobile phones, mobile communication gadgets recovered from suspects

Delta state Police Command on Wednesday paraded 123 internet fraudsters at the Ekpan Police Divisional Headquarters Ekpan Uvwie local government area of Delta State.

HK suspects

The State Police Public Relations Officer, SP Bright Edafe told Journalists that the suspected internet fraudsters popularly known as HK group were arrested by soldiers of 3 battalion Nigeria army at the weekend and handed over to the police at Ekpan .

The Police Public Relations officer ,PPRO stated that the suspected internet fraudsters were arrested at the popular Army Estate, Effurun .

SP Edafe Bright
Delta PPRO

He said after interrogation with the suspects,the police discovered that among them were two chairmen who recruited the boys between the ages of 17 and 25 into the HK training school after deceiving some of them that they are into forex training .
Others were lured into it because they wants to get rich .

He disclosed that some of the suspects have been in the HK training school for over three months without contacting their parents .
” I wonder why parents will not report to the police that their child is missing ,most of these issues are caused by poor parenting” he stated .

He revealed that One of the suspects used the laptop given to him to defraud unsuspected victims to chat with his mother and disclosed where they are camped in the HK “Hustle Kingdom” school ( a cybercriminal training network school) at Army estate.
“They maltreat the trainees,seized their phones as soon as they are into the school ,feed them once a day,locked them inside the building”he said.

Edafe disclosed that the suspected internet fraudsters came from different parts of the country including Kaduna, Kwara,Lagos ,Anambra , kogi and Benue .

He also disclosed that the army arrested 4 drivers who were to carry the suspects to another location not knowing that they were attempting to escape out of the Army Estate
The divers were released after the police found out that they know nothing about the suspects mission.

He revealed that the 123 suspected internet fraudsters will be charged to court today ( Wednesday).
It will be recalled that armed military operatives stormed the HK school and arrested over one hundred of the suspects in the early hours of Saturday.
